Germany has announced plans to transfer 77 Leopard 1A5 tanks to Ukraine - reports Spiegel
Germany, in cooperation with Denmark and the Netherlands, plans to supply Ukraine with an additional 77 Leopard 1A5 tanks, and wants to do so as quickly as possible, said German Defence Minister Boris Pistorius.
, said Pistorius at a press conference at Ramstein Air Base.
In addition, he announced the transfer of another 12 German self-propelled howitzers Panzerhaubitze 2000 to Ukraine, six of which will be delivered by the end of the year. Germany will also continue to train Ukrainian soldiers, emphasized Pistorius. According to him, since November 2022, over 16,000 Ukrainian Armed Forces personnel have already undergone training in Germany.

🇹🇷🇺🇸 Turkey will no longer receive F-35 fighter jets
The American publication National Interest reports that Turkey's return to the F-35 program is unlikely due to a number of geopolitical factors.
One of the "main" reasons is the presence of Russian S-400 air defence systems on Turkish soil, which raises serious concerns in Washington. Additionally, other issues stand in the way of Turkey's re-engagement in the program, such as the use of Huawei equipment in building 5G networks, escalating tensions with Greece, and closer ties with Russia.
Essentially, Washington expects Ankara to fully comply with its demands, even to the point of unconditional obedience, similar to EU members. Any deviation from this course is met with sharp criticism.
☝️ It is worth noting that Turkey has already realised the consequences of these events and has shifted its focus to the F-16 program. Ankara has signed multi-billion dollar contracts for the purchase of new and the modernisation of existing F-16 fighter jets.
In the future, Turkey plans to develop its own fifth-generation fighter jets, relying on cooperation with non-NATO countries.
